Abstract
We present a novel distributed implementation of Multiple Hypothesis Tracking (MHT). Our implementation is based on Merkle-Tree (hash-tree) distributed content storing approach. The proposed architecture makes use of recent advances in cryptographic signatures to enable fast operations on local trees and also allow sharing of hypotheses between local and remote nodes. Finally, the proposed architecture also allows for natural handling of out-of-sequence-measurements.
